Table 5.
Other outcomes reported in oligosaccharide interventions reporting on bacterial composition.
Reference | Fiber Type | Evidence of Fermentation | Evidence of Fecal Bulking | Evidence of Changes in Transit Time | Evidence of Other Changes in Host Physiology |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
[35] | FOS | S | NS | -- | S: GI symptoms (mild bloating) |
NS: Fecal pH | |||||
[36] | FOS | NS | -- | -- | S: GI symptoms (excess flatus) |
NS: Fecal pH | |||||
[37] | FOS | S | -- | -- | NS: GI symptoms |
GOS | S | -- | -- | NS: GI symptoms | |
[38] | FOS | -- | -- | NS | NS: GI symptoms, fecal pH |
GOS | -- | -- | NS | NS: GI symptoms, fecal pH | |
SB-OS | -- | -- | NS | NS: GI symptoms, fecal pH | |
[39] | FOS | -- | -- | -- | -- |
[40] | FOS | S | S | -- | S: GI symptoms (flatulence and intestinal bloating) |
NS: fecal water pH | |||||
[41] | FOS | -- | -- | -- | S: GI symptoms |
NS: fecal pH | |||||
[42] | GOS | -- | -- | -- | -- |
GOS | -- | -- | -- | -- | |
[43] | GOS | -- | -- | -- | NS: Total and HDL cholesterol# |
[44] | FOS | -- | -- | -- | S: GI symptoms |
[45] | AX-OS | -- | NS | -- | NS: Total, LDL, and HDL cholesterol # |
[46] | GOS | -- | -- | -- | NS: GI symptoms, stool consistency # |
[47] | X-OS | S | -- | -- | NS: Stool consistency # |
[48] | AX-OS | S | -- | S | NS: Stool consistency # |
[49] | AX-OS | S | -- | NS | NS: Total energy intake, total and LDL cholesterol #, stool consistency |
[50] | AX-OS | S | -- | -- | -- |
[51] | AX-OS | S | NS | NS | NS: LDL cholesterol #, fasting insulin and glucose, stool consistency |
[52] | GOS | -- | -- | -- | S: Total cholesterol and insulin |
NS: LDL, and HDL cholesterol, triglycerides, or fasting glucose | |||||
[53] | AX-OS | S | -- | NS | NS: GI symptoms |
[54] | X-OS | NS | -- | NS | NS: Fecal pH, GI symptoms |
[55] | GOS | -- | NS | S | S: Satiety, total energy intake |
NS: Weight/Adiposity | |||||
[56] | GOS | S | NS | NS | -- |
Abbreviations: AX-OS, arabinoxylan-oligosaccharides; FOS, fructooligosaccharides; GOS, galactooligosaccharides; NS, no statistically significant health benefit was observed; S, a significant effect was observed; SB-OS, soybean oligosaccharides; X-OS, xylo-oligosaccharides; # No significant effect of intervention, but the effect was in a direction opposite to providing a health benefit.
